Olivia Newton-John’s film career hit a major bump with just her second movie appearance. She starred as a roller skate-clad muse opposite Michael Beck and Gene Kelly in the 1980 musical Xanadu, a film so bad it led to the creation of the Golden Raspberry Awards.
The glitzy groan-fest has become something of a cult classic since, and even inspired a Broadway musical in 2007 that was nominated for multiple Tonys. But at the time, the film was a massive misstep.
